The table below represents the volume of a liquid sample as a function of its temperature:
Temperature (°C) Volume(ml) f (x)
11 95
16 100
21 105
26 110
The average rate of change of f(x) between x = 11 to x = 21 is _____ml per °C and represents the rate of change of volume per degree rise in temperature.
